Obviously, i'm new to modding, and am still figuring out the basics, however i'm lead to understand that I should be able to play on my maps even after the first munge. Though for some reason that isn't the case for me. If I try to play on my imcomplete custom map, (which when I select it the text and description is orange and messed up.) the game crashes and says "FATAL: Could not open mission lvl."
After looking into this, the folder of my custom map DOES go to the addon folder as it's supposed to, however, there is no lvl file in it (which i'm guessing is the issue.)
I downloaded the "vistamungefix" (even though I use Windows 7 which may explain why this download didn't work) but I didn't understand what I was to do with it. As in, is there something in that folder I use or do I just dump the files into the "BF2 Mod tools folder" none of those seem to work.

It may be called vistamungefix, but it can be used for any OS released after XP.NovaSpartanX wrote:I downloaded the "vistamungefix" (even though I use Windows 7 which may explain why this download didn't work) but I didn't understand what I was to do with it. As in, is there something in that folder I use or do I just dump the files into the "BF2 Mod tools folder" none of those seem to work.
To use the mungefix just follow these steps as posted already:
- Extract the vistamungefix folder into your C:\BF2_ModTools directory.
Run the vistamungefix.bat located inside the vistamungefix folder.
The path to vistamungefix.bat should look like this:
- C:\BF2_ModTools\vistamungefix\vistamungefix.bat
